AI Today BriefПідписатися
optimization

Попередньо індексовані графи знань коду скорочують виклики інструментів агентами на 94 відсотки

26 травня 2026 р. · Редактор — Oleksandr Kuzmenko

CodeGraph збирає абстрактне синтаксичне дерево вашого репозиторію в структурований граф, дозволяючи агентам миттєво знаходити зв'язки без тривалих пошуків.

Чому це важливо

Ви можете значно прискорити виконання команд у Claude Code та зменшити рахунки за API, надавши агентам миттєві структури зв'язків у вашому коді.

Ключові висновки

  • Створюйте локальний індекс CodeGraph для репозиторію перед запуском консольного ШІ-агента
  • Прискорюйте складні цикли рефакторингу, вирішуючи залежності за один запит
  • Налаштуйте автоматичний git-хук для оновлення графу коду при важливих комітах

Коли ШІ-агенти аналізують великий код, вони витрачають значну частину ліміту токенів API на послідовні виклики інструментів (пошук файлів, зчитування папок, grep). CodeGraph вирішує цю проблему, попередньо збираючи весь ваш репозиторій у оптимізований граф знань коду, що скорочує зайві виклики інструментів у агентних процесах на 94 відсотки.

Замість того, щоб дозволяти агенту опитувати файли по черзі, CodeGraph заздалегідь розбирає абстрактне синтаксичне дерево (AST) вашого коду для побудови єдиної карти символів, імпортів, класів та ієрархій викликів. Коли агент робить запит щодо певного компонента, CodeGraph повертає всю структуру зв'язків за один раз, уникаючи довгих циклів запитів-відповідей.

Якщо ви використовуєте Claude Code для рефакторингу складного бекенду на NestJS або TypeScript, ви можете спочатку запустити CodeGraph. Замість десятків викликів пошуку для з'ясування схем бази даних та структури сервісів, Claude миттєво отримає всі залежності з графу, заощадивши значні кошти.

Звісно, граф потрібно оновлювати після серйозних архітектурних змін, що вимагає налаштування автоматичного переіндексування в CLI під час активної роботи.

CodeGraph є критично важливим інструментом оптимізації для кожного розробника, який використовує консольні ШІ-агенти у великих проєктах.

Джерело: Github